Why Timing Matters on Instagram
Instagram’s algorithm prioritizes content that gets rapid engagement, and when you post plays a huge role in that. If you publish when your audience is most active, you’re more likely to earn likes, comments, and saves—signaling to the algorithm that your post deserves a broader reach.
So, why focus on **Wednesday**? Midweek is often a sweet spot between Monday chaos and Friday fatigue. Users tend to check Instagram throughout the day during breaks at work or school. Let’s explore how you can make the most of this window.
Understanding the Instagram Algorithm in 2024
Before you can master the best time to post Instagram Wednesday, you need to understand how the Instagram algorithm currently works:
- Engagement-based: Posts with high likes, comments, and shares are prioritized.
- Recency: Newer posts get preference in the feed, meaning time matters.
- Interest Prediction: Instagram serves posts it thinks users will interact with, based on past behavior.
Leveraging this, timing your post for when followers are online gives your content a performance boost right out of the gate.
What Is the Best Time to Post Instagram Wednesday?
Based on aggregated social media usage data and real-time engagement metrics, here’s the consensus for the best time to post Instagram Wednesday:
- Primary Time Window: 11:00 AM to 1:00 PM (your local time)
- Secondary Spike: 5:00 PM to 6:30 PM
Posting during these hours aligns with lunch breaks and post-work downtime, when users typically check their feeds. These time blocks consistently yield higher impressions, click-throughs, and engagement.
Why These Times Work
Studies show that midweek activity on Instagram peaks during late morning and early evening hours. Here’s what happens:
- People scroll during lunch breaks (11 AM–1 PM) to escape weekdays’ routines.
- After work (5 PM–6:30 PM), users are relaxed and spending time on mobile.
- Midweek motivation levels are higher; people are more responsive to promotional and inspirational content.
Make sure your post aligns with these behavioral patterns to maximize engagement.

How to Find Your Audience’s Active Times
While general data helps, your audience may deviate from the norm. Here’s how to identify your own personal best time to post Instagram Wednesday:
- Use Instagram Insights: Go to your professional account, view Insights → Audience, and scroll to “Most Active Times” by day.
- Schedule Test Posts: Try posting at different times (morning, noon, evening) over several Wednesdays and track performance.
Monitor your post analytics weekly to spot trends and shifts.
Pro Tips to Optimize Your Wednesday Instagram Posts
Once you’ve nailed down the best time to post Instagram Wednesday, use these tips to increase your content’s effectiveness:
- Post Reels and Carousels: They boost watch time and spark interaction.
- Use SEO-friendly captions: Include keywords and context to improve searchability.
- Engage Immediately: Respond to comments within 30 minutes to signal activity to the algorithm.
- Leverage Hashtags: Use niche and trending hashtags to expand reach.
- Tease Stories: Announce your new post via Instagram Stories to increase initial traffic.
Combining smart timing with optimized content ensures your posts don’t just exist—they thrive.
